According to energy industry reports, New Jersey has positioned itself as a leading state in the development of next-generation nuclear technology. The state recently enacted legislation establishing a competitive procurement process to source a minimum of 1,100 megawatts of power from small modular reactors (SMRs) and other advanced nuclear projects. The initiative reflects growing momentum in the nuclear sector as policymakers and utilities seek scalable solutions to meet increasing energy demand while reducing carbon emissions.
Small modular reactors represent a significant departure from traditional large-scale nuclear infrastructure, offering potential cost advantages and greater flexibility in deployment. Industry advocates argue that SMRs can be manufactured at lower capital costs than conventional reactors and adapted for diverse applications across industrial and residential settings. As states nationwide grapple with decarbonization goals and grid reliability, SMRs have emerged as a viable pathway to expand nuclear capacity without the extensive infrastructure commitments required by conventional facilities.
New Jersey's procurement process signals broader confidence in advanced nuclear technology as a critical component of the nation's energy transition. The competitive bidding framework will allow developers to propose projects that meet the state's specifications, potentially accelerating the commercialization of SMR technology while supporting the region's clean energy objectives.
